The Canon PIXMA G1310 is a compact, all-in-one inkjet printer with a focus on low ink costs and high page yield. It’s designed for home use and offers basic printing, scanning, and copying functions.

Canon MegaTank G1310 setup on iPhone & iPad
- Connect Printer to Wi-Fi:
- Make sure the printer is turned on.
- Follow the instructions in the printer’s manual to connect it to your Wi-Fi network.
- Download and Install Canon PRINT:
- Open the App Store on your iPhone or iPad.
- Search for “Canon PRINT” and download and install the app.
- Register Printer in Canon PRINT:
- Open the Canon PRINT app.
- Follow the on-screen instructions to register your printer. This usually involves tapping “Register Printer” and following the prompts to connect to your printer.
- If your printer isn’t automatically found, you may need to select “If Printer Cannot be Found” and follow the instructions to manually connect.
- Test Printing:
- Once the printer is registered, you can test printing by opening a document or photo and selecting “Print”.
Canon MegaTank G1310 setup on Android
- Download and Install the App:
- Open the Google Play Store on your Android device.
- Search for “Canon PRINT Inkjet/SELPHY” and download the app.
- Ensure Printer is Connected:
- Make sure your Pixma G1310 is turned on and connected to your home Wi-Fi network.
- Open the Canon PRINT App:
- Open the Canon PRINT app on your Android device.
- Register the Printer:
- Follow the app’s prompts to register your Pixma G1310. This usually involves searching for compatible printers on your network.
- Set Up Printing:
- The app may guide you through setting up default print settings or allow you to customize them.
